What is Depth of Field (DoF)?
Depth of Field refers to the range within an image, both in front of and behind the point of focus, that appears acceptably sharp. Simply put, it's the depth of the area in your image that looks clear.

Shallow Depth of Field: Only a narrow region around the focal point is sharp, with the background and foreground appearing blurred. This is often used to highlight a subject, create artistic effects, or filter out background clutter in object detection.

Deep Depth of Field: Most of the image, from foreground to background, appears sharp. This is crucial in applications like surveillance, measurement, and 3D scanning, where comprehensive clarity is required.

Why is Depth of Field So Important?
In professional camera module applications, the choice of DoF directly impacts the usability of the final image and overall system performance:

Image Quality and Information Capture: Different applications have varying requirements for the range of clarity. For instance, in industrial inspection, you might need a deep DoF to ensure the entire surface of the inspected object is clear. In facial recognition or biometric applications, a shallow DoF helps to concentrate focus on the face, reducing background interference.

System Design and Optimization: DoF control influences lens selection, aperture settings, and the distance between the camera and the subject. Understanding DoF helps engineers design more precise systems and optimize performance.

How to Control Depth of Field: The Three Key Factors
DoF isn't a fixed value; it can be precisely controlled using three primary factors:

Aperture Size:

Large aperture (small f-number, e.g., f/1.4): Produces a shallow depth of field, blurring the background and isolating the subject. This typically means more light enters, suitable for low-light environments or scenarios emphasizing the main subject.

Small aperture (large f-number, e.g., f/16): Results in a deep depth of field, keeping most of the scene sharp. This is highly useful in surveillance or measurement applications where capturing more detail or ensuring overall scene clarity is vital.

Focal Length:

Longer focal length lenses: Lead to a shallower depth of field. Thus, telephoto lenses are often used in portrait photography or long-distance shooting to blur backgrounds.

Wide-angle lenses: Result in a deeper depth of field. Wide-angle lenses excel in landscape photography or applications requiring a large range of sharpness.

Focus Distance:

Shorter focus distance: Produces an even shallower depth of field. Macro photography is a prime example where the background is significantly blurred.

Longer focus distance: Results in a deeper depth of field. When shooting distant scenes, the DoF is generally larger.

Camera Modules: The Core of Your Product's Vision System
A camera module is a miniaturized vision capture system that integrates all necessary components into a compact unit. This includes the lens responsible for focusing light, the image sensor (typically the efficient CMOS type) that converts light signals into electrical signals, and the circuit board (PCB) housing the processing electronics. They work in concert to transform real-world images into data that digital devices can understand.

The essence of a camera module lies in its precise design, enabling it to:

Capture light: Through the lens and infrared filter, ensuring the quality of light entering the sensor.

Image conversion: The image sensor accurately converts light into digital signals.

Data optimization: The built-in Digital Signal Processor (DSP) enhances, color-corrects, and compresses images, ensuring high-quality output as images or videos.

Diverse Camera Module Types to Meet Different Needs
Based on application scenarios and connection methods, camera modules come in various types:

Compact Camera Modules (CCMs): Widely used in mobile devices, striving for ultimate compactness and performance.

USB Camera Modules: With their plug-and-play convenience, they are ideal for video conferencing, live streaming, and various general vision applications.

MIPI/FPC Camera Modules: Offer high-speed, low-power data transfer, making them the preferred choice for high-performance embedded devices and smartphones.

Each type has its unique advantages, adapting to a broad range of demands from consumer electronics to industrial applications.
